Cleo & Cuquin
Cleo & Cuquin
TV2018

Cleo & Cuquin

Loading ratings...

Sister and brother Cleo and Cuquin carry out different job roles to help their friends.

Released: 2018Category: tvStatus: EndedLanguage: Spanish
More info

My Followings Reviews

Others Reviews